窗体可以通过菜单启动,可以通过与菜单关联的按钮启动,也可以通过代码启动,通过代码启动有两种方法:
1.通过调用FormRun类.(无法从窗体外调用窗体方法)
static void AXD_CallForm_FormRun(Args _args)
{ FormRun m_form; Args m_args = new Args(); m_args.name(formStr(SalesTable));
m_form = classFactory.formRunClass(m_args); m_form.init(); m_form.run(); m_form.detach(); } 2.通过Object类.(可以从窗体外调用窗体方法) static void AXD_CallForm_Object(Args _args)
{ Object m_form; Args m_args = new Args(); m_args.name(formStr(SalesTable));
m_form = classFactory.formRunClass(m_args); m_form.init(); m_form.run(); m_form.detach(); } |
|
来自: 拳毛弧的藏经阁 > 《Dynamics AX》